Standardized Procedures

One of the key components of proper inventory management in a diagnostic lab setting is the implementation of standardized procedures for handling and tracking medical specimens. By establishing clear protocols for specimen collection, labeling, storage, and disposal, labs can ensure consistency and minimize the risk of errors or mix-ups. Standardized procedures should cover all aspects of specimen management, from the moment it is collected to when it is tested and stored.

Key Points:

  1. Develop written protocols for specimen collection, labeling, and transportation.
  2. Train staff members on proper handling procedures to reduce the risk of contamination or sample mix-ups.
  3. Establish guidelines for specimen storage and disposal to ensure samples are properly maintained and disposed of in a timely manner.

Regular Audits

Conducting regular audits of specimen inventory is essential for identifying Discrepancies, errors, or missing samples in a diagnostic lab setting. By performing routine audits, labs can ensure the accuracy and completeness of their inventory, identify any issues or trends that require attention, and take corrective action as needed. Audits should be thorough and systematic, with a focus on verifying the location, quantity, and condition of all specimens in the lab.

Key Points:

  1. Establish a schedule for conducting regular audits of specimen inventory.
  2. Assign specific staff members to perform the audits and document their findings.
  3. Address any Discrepancies or issues identified during the audit process promptly to prevent future errors.

Record Keeping

Maintaining accurate records of specimen inventory is essential for tracking usage, monitoring expiration dates, and ensuring compliance with regulatory requirements in a diagnostic lab setting. Labs should keep detailed records of all specimens received, tested, and stored, including the date of collection, type of specimen, patient information, and Test Results. By maintaining comprehensive and up-to-date records, labs can easily track specimens, identify any issues or Discrepancies, and demonstrate compliance with industry standards.

Key Points:

  1. Establish a centralized system for storing and managing specimen inventory records.
  2. Regularly update records with new information and track changes to specimen status or location.
  3. Review records regularly to identify any missing or expired specimens and take appropriate action to resolve any issues.
